Biden calls chef Jose Andres after Israeli strike kills World Central Kitchen aid workers

Source: NBC News

April 2, 2024, 2:21 PM EDT


WASHINGTON — President Joe Biden has called world-renowned chef José Andrés "to express that he's heartbroken" after an Israeli airstrike killed seven aid workers in Gaza from the chef's World Central Kitchen organization.

"The president conveyed he is grieving with the entire World Central Kitchen family," White House press secretary Karine Jean-Pierre told reporters during the daily press briefing.

She continued, "The president felt it was important to recognize the tremendous contribution World Central Kitchen has made to the people in Gaza and people around the world. The president conveyed he will make clear to Israel that humanitarian aid workers must be protected."

National Security Council spokesman John Kirby, who joined the press briefing, said the Biden administration is "outraged" by the strike, which Israel said unintentionally killed the aid workers Monday. The Israel Defense Forces said it would conduct a preliminary investigation into the incident and Kirby said that he expects Israel to also perform a broader investigation.
